Tax Consulting and Compliance

Pitcher Partners have one of the largest and most experienced tax consulting divisions in Melbourne, with a number of specialists particularly knowledgeable in tax issues affecting the sector. We assist a number of clients in establishing and operating Not For Profits for:

• income tax exemption status;
• deductible gift recipient status; and
• mutual income.

We also:
• provide advice to Not For Profits in relation to reviews of Deductible Gift Recipient (DGR) status and income tax exemption status;
• in dealing with Revenue Authorities in relation to disputes; and
• employment tax related issues including FBT and payroll tax advice
